This is quite the result for Labour.

They won this by just over 20 votes. The ward covers the Teesworks site.
South Bank (Redcar & Cleveland) Council By-Election Result:

🌹 LAB: 47.4% (-17.8)
➡️ RFM: 44.3% (New)
🌳 CON: 8.2% (-4.3)

No Ind (-22.2) as previous.

Labour HOLD.
Changes w/ 2023.

This story about a Reform councillor in Northumberland has about three different massive stories in it.

He's accused of ripping off his constituents to the tune of £140k.

He owes his own council nearly £40k in unpaid tax.

His own council is suing him.
Blyth Reform councillor Barry Elliott's property firms owe customers £140,000
Property companies owned or run by Barry Elliott owe tens of thousands of pounds to customers.
